Chipping Sodbury is a historic market town situated at the foot of the Cotswold Escarpment, famous for its exceptionally long and wide High Street flanked by a dense concentration of Grade II and Grade II* listed buildings. The geography of the town is defined by its position on the edge of the Frome Valley, where the limestone hills transition into the clay vales of South Gloucestershire. This positioning creates a microclimate characterized by high levels of wind-driven rain and moisture-laden air that is forced upwards against the escarpment. A roof leak in Chipping Sodbury is a significant threat to the town’s architectural heritage, particularly for the medieval and Georgian properties that feature traditional Cotswold stone slates or high-quality Welsh slates. When a leak occurs in this environment, it is frequently driven by ‘capillary action’ in the overlapping stone courses or the failure of the original iron ‘nails’ and timber ‘pegs’—a condition often referred to as ‘nail sickness’ in the older slate roofs. The town’s high density of parapet walls and valley gutters, typical of Georgian architecture, creates natural traps for organic debris and silt. If these gutters are not maintained, water backs up under the lead flashings and penetrates the building’s envelope, saturating the ancient timber rafters and the historic lath-and-plaster ceilings. Furthermore, the porous nature of the local limestone means that persistent leaks can lead to ‘spalling,’ where the stone face flakes away due to the freeze-thaw cycle. Chipping Sodbury is an ancient market town in South Gloucestershire, located on the edge of the Cotswold Hills near Bristol. 1. The town was founded in the 12th century by William Crassus and is famous for having one of the longest and widest medieval high streets in England. 2. The name ‘Chipping’ is derived from the Old English ‘ceapung,’ meaning a market or place of trade, reflecting its history as a major commercial hub. 3. Chipping Sodbury is the birthplace of J.K. Rowling, the author of the Harry Potter series, who lived in the town during her childhood. 4. Geographically, the town is situated on the River Frome, which historically provided water power for several mills and industrial processes. 5. The town’s architecture is a stunning mix of medieval, Tudor, and Georgian styles, with many buildings constructed from the local golden-hued limestone. 6. Historically, Chipping Sodbury was a major centre for the wool and cloth trade, benefiting from its location on the ancient route between Bristol and London. 7. The town is home to the ‘Sodbury Mop,’ a traditional hiring fair that dates back centuries and continues as a popular local festival twice a year. 8. The parish church of St John the Baptist dates from the 13th century and features significant Perpendicular Gothic architecture and a rare ‘preaching cross’ in the churchyard. 9. The town is surrounded by ‘Common Land’ which has remained undeveloped for centuries, preserving the rural character of the town’s setting. 10. Historically, Chipping Sodbury was a key stop for coaching traffic, with several historic inns like ‘The Royal Oak’ serving travelers for hundreds of years. 11. The local geology includes significant deposits of ‘Sodbury Limestone,’ which was historically quarried for building and road construction. 12. The town features a unique ‘Town Trust’ that manages various historic assets and maintains the traditional character of the market place. 13. Historically, the town was significant for its malting and brewing industries, utilizing the high-quality grain grown on the surrounding Cotswold plateau. 14. Chipping Sodbury is located near the ‘Cotswold Way’ and is a popular starting point for walkers exploring the South Cotswold escarpment. 15. Today, the town remains a vibrant and prestigious community, cherished for its architectural integrity, independent shops, and deep sense of historical continuity.

A leaking roof can develop for many reasons. Broken or slipped tiles, cracked flashing, blocked gutters, and ageing materials are among the most frequent causes. Flat roof leak issues are particularly common due to pooling water, while pitched roofs often suffer from tiled roof leak or slate roof leak problems when individual tiles fail.
Chimneys are another weak point, and a chimney roof leak can occur when mortar or flashing deteriorates. Similarly, a roof flashing leak around vents or joints can allow rainwater to penetrate unnoticed until damage becomes visible indoors.
Some roof leaks are obvious, but others can remain hidden for months. Water leaking from roof spaces may appear as stains on ceilings, bubbling paint, or damp patches on walls. Roof leak ceiling damage is often the first visible sign homeowners notice.
